As a Junior Help Desk Technician, you can support the organization's vital functions. You will be working closely with the client service desk and offer deskside support. Some functions of a Junior Help Desk Technician include resolving customer technical issues, collecting, analyzing, and reporting trends, providing on-site support, and offering services, among others.
As a Junior Help Desk Technician, you can earn an annual average salary of $50,474. This work has a growth rate of 10%, so you do not need to worry about the demand. You also have the chance to take on other roles and further your career when you start as a Junior Help Desk Technician. You can be a Technician, a Technical Support Specialist, a Systems Administrator, and an Information Technology Manager.
If you want to know about the skills and knowledge most Junior Help Desk Technician applicants write in their resumes, you can use this to your advantage. Some things included in their resumes are Knowledge Base, Hardware, Escalation skills, Active Directory, and Technical Support.

The average Junior Help Desk Technician salary in the United States is $48,069 per year or $23 per hour. Junior help desk technician salaries range between $35,000 and $65,000 per year.
